The Role of Lighting in Modern Design
Lighting is often underestimated, yet it plays a crucial role in shaping the mood and functionality of a space. It's far more than just providing illumination; it’s a design element that can dramatically alter the perception of a room. Warm, inviting light can create a cozy atmosphere, while bright, focused light can enhance productivity and showcase artwork. Different types of lighting – ambient, task, and accent – serve different purposes, and layering these types is essential for creating a well-lit and visually appealing interior. Thoughtfully chosen lighting fixtures can serve as sculptural elements, adding personality and interest to a room.
Exploring Different Lighting Styles
The range of lighting styles available is vast, from minimalist pendants to ornate chandeliers. Selecting the right style depends on the overall aesthetic of the space and the desired mood. Industrial-inspired lighting fixtures with exposed bulbs and metal finishes can add a touch of edginess, while classic designs with fabric shades and brass accents evoke a sense of timeless elegance. Modern LED lighting offers energy efficiency and versatility, allowing for a wide range of effects and color temperatures. Consider the scale of the fixture in relation to the room – a large chandelier can become a focal point, while smaller sconces provide subtle accent lighting.
- Pendant Lights: Ideal for kitchens, dining areas, and entryways.
- Table Lamps: Provide targeted lighting for reading or relaxing.
- Floor Lamps: Add ambient light and height to a room.
- Sconces: Offer wall-mounted accent lighting.
- Chandeliers: Create a dramatic focal point in a living or dining space.
When choosing lighting, consider not only the style but also the functionality. Dimmers allow you to adjust the brightness to create different moods, and smart lighting systems offer even greater control and convenience. With the right lighting, you can transform a space from ordinary to extraordinary.
Textiles and Soft Furnishings: Adding Comfort and Texture
Textiles and soft furnishings are essential for adding comfort, warmth, and texture to a living space. Rugs, cushions, throws, and curtains not only enhance the aesthetic appeal of a room but also create a sense of coziness and invitation. Layering different textures – such as velvet, linen, and wool – adds depth and visual interest to a space. Choosing the right colors and patterns can also have a significant impact on the overall mood – bold colors and geometric patterns create a vibrant and energetic atmosphere, while muted tones and subtle textures evoke a sense of calm and serenity. These elements are vital for transforming a house into a home.
Selecting the Right Fabrics for Your Home
The choice of fabric depends on several factors, including the intended use, the aesthetic, and the level of maintenance required. Linen is a versatile and breathable fabric that is ideal for curtains, upholstery, and bedding. Velvet adds a touch of luxury and sophistication, while cotton is a durable and affordable option for everyday use. Wool is a warm and insulating fabric that is perfect for rugs and throws. When selecting fabrics, consider the durability, stain resistance, and ease of cleaning. Natural fibers are generally more sustainable and environmentally friendly than synthetic fabrics.
- Assess the Use: How will the fabric be used? (e.g., upholstery, curtains, bedding)
- Consider Durability: How much wear and tear will the fabric be subjected to?
- Choose Colors and Patterns: How will the fabric complement the existing décor?
- Think About Maintenance: How easy will it be to clean and care for the fabric?
- Prioritize Sustainability: Opt for natural fibers like linen, cotton, or wool whenever possible.
Investing in high-quality textiles and soft furnishings can transform a space, adding comfort, style, and personality. By carefully considering the fabric choices, you can create a home that is both beautiful and functional.

Beyond Aesthetics: Functionality and Practicality
While aesthetics are undoubtedly important, a truly successful interior design prioritizes functionality and practicality. A beautiful space is useless if it doesn’t meet the needs of those who live in it. Consider how the space will be used and choose furniture and decor that supports those activities. Storage solutions are essential for keeping a home organized and clutter-free. Multi-functional furniture, such as sofa beds and storage ottomans, can maximize space in smaller homes. A well-designed interior is one that seamlessly integrates aesthetics and functionality, creating a space that is both beautiful and livable. It’s not about sacrificing one for the other; it’s about finding the right balance.
Don’t underestimate the importance of considering the flow of traffic within a space. Furniture should be arranged in a way that allows for easy movement and doesn’t obstruct pathways. Lighting should be positioned to provide adequate illumination for specific tasks. And finally, always prioritize comfort – choose furniture that is comfortable and inviting, and create a space that feels welcoming and relaxing. The ultimate goal is to create a home that is not only visually appealing but also enhances your quality of life.
